中药残渣发酵添加剂对蛋鸡生产性能及抗氧化能力的影响

为研究中药残渣发酵添加剂对蛋鸡生产性能及机体抗氧化水平的影响,试验选取4 000只蛋鸡随机分成4组,在基础日粮中分别添加0、1%、2%、3%的中药发酵添加剂进行饲养试验后,对蛋鸡的产蛋性能、蛋品质以及血清抗氧化指标进行测定。结果表明:Ⅲ、Ⅳ组的产蛋率和平均蛋重显著高于Ⅰ、Ⅱ组(P<0。05),Ⅲ、Ⅳ组的平均日采食量和料蛋比显著低于Ⅰ、Ⅱ组(P<0。05),其中Ⅲ组的产蛋率、平均蛋重、平均日采食量更高,料蛋比更低,Ⅲ组和Ⅳ组间无显著差异(P>0。05);所有组的蛋壳强度、蛋壳厚度、蛋白高度无显著差异(P>0。05),但Ⅱ、Ⅲ、Ⅳ组蛋黄颜色均显著高于Ⅰ组(P<0。05),Ⅲ组和Ⅳ组的哈氏单位显著高于Ⅰ组和Ⅱ组(P<0。05);Ⅲ、Ⅳ组GSH-Px、SOD含量较Ⅰ、Ⅱ组显著升高(P<0。05),Ⅲ、Ⅳ组的MDA含量较Ⅰ、Ⅱ组显著下降(P<0。05)。综上所述,饲料中添加中药发酵添加剂可显著改善蛋鸡生产性能,提高机体抗氧化能力。添加2%与3%的中药发酵添加剂效果最佳,结合经济角度考虑,添加2%的中药发酵添加剂更为适宜。
Effects of Chinese Herbal Fermentation Additive on Performance and Antioxidant Ability of Laying Hens
The aim of this experiment was to study the effects of Chinese herbal fermentation additive perfor-mance and antioxidant level of laying hens.A total of 4 000 laying hens were divided into 4 groups,and the laying performance,egg quality and serum antioxidant indexes of laying hens were measured after feeding experiment with Chinese herbal fermentation additive in the basal diet at the ratio of 0,1%,2%and 3%.The results show that the laying rate and average egg weight in groups Ⅲ and Ⅳ were significantly higher than those in groups Ⅰ and Ⅱ(P<0.05),the average daily feed intake and feed to egg ratio in groups Ⅲ andⅣ were significantly lower than those in groupsⅠandⅡ(P<0.05),and there were no significant differences in all the above indexes in groups Ⅲ and Ⅳ(P>0.05);there were no significant differences in eggshell strength,eggshell thickness and protein height among all groups(P>0.05),but yolk color in groups Ⅱ,Ⅲand Ⅳ were significantly higher than that in groupⅠ(P<0.05),and Haugh unit in groups Ⅲ and Ⅳwere significantly higher than that in groups Ⅰand Ⅱ(P<0.05).After the experiment,the con-tents of GSH-Px and SOD in groups Ⅲ and Ⅳwere significantly increased compared with groupsⅠ and Ⅱ(P<0.05),and the MDA content in groups Ⅲ and Ⅳ were significantly decreased compared with groups Ⅰ and Ⅱ(P<0.05).In summary,the addition of Chinese herbal fermentation additive to the diets can effectively promote the production perfor-mance of laying hens and improve their antioxidant capacity.Under the experimental conditions,the effect of adding 2%and 3%of Chinese herbal fermentation additive is the best,and considering the economic per-spective,adding 2%of Chinese herbal fermentation additive is more suitable.
